(PV 420) Off-Grid PV System Load Analysis & Design
This four-hour course covers battery-based PV system components – from modules and array configurations to batteries, charge controllers, and inverters. Participants will review design principles for sizing battery-based PV systems, beginning with a thorough analysis of daily loads. Based on those load requirements, choices for system voltage and amp-hour capacity of the battery bank will be discussed and determined. Finally, participants will select appropriate system components and configure them to complete the stand-alone PV system.
Students can work through recorded presentations and exercises at their own pace. When the coursework is finished, a completion certificate is issued.
